- Day 2
Siem Reap
After breakfast, head out to explore Angkor's temple complex. You'll start with Angkor Wat, then move through Angkor Thom's South Gate, Bayon, and Baphoun. Later, check out the Terraces of Elephants and Leper King before visiting Ta Prom, that famous temple from the Tomb Raider film. Banteay Kdei comes next. By evening, you'll catch the sunset either at one of the temples or by Sras Srong lake, which dates back about 1000 years. Finish with a traditional Khmer buffet dinner and watch an Apsara performance.

- Day 3
Siem Reap
After breakfast, you're heading to Chong Kneas Floating Village on Tonle Sap Lake. A traditional wooden boat will take you out to see how local fishermen work. During the wet season, this becomes one of Asia's largest freshwater lakes. Back in town, browse The Made in Cambodia Market for souvenirs, then grab lunch at a local spot. Your afternoon is free to do whatever you want, whether that's resting at your hotel or exploring more of Siem Reap.

Siem Reap
After breakfast, you'll travel about 48km to Phnom Kulen, also called Lychee Mountain. This national park reaches 487 meters at its highest point. You'll see a pagoda housing a Reclining Buddha, find the sacred fertility carvings, and walk along the riverbed where over 1000 Lingas are carved into the sandstone. There's also a stone representation of the Hindu god Vishnu, and you'll end at a waterfall before having a picnic lunch on the mountain. Then you'll head back to your hotel to relax for the rest of the day.
